DOI QR코드

DOI QR Code

An Internet Gateway Based Link State Routing for Infrastructure-Based Mobile Ad Hoc Networks

인프라구조 기반의 이동 애드혹 네트워크를 위한 인터넷 게이트웨이 중심의 링크상태 라우팅 프로토콜

  • 이성욱 (포항산업과학연구원) ;
  • 오지충 (울산대학교 전기공학부 조선해양IT융합연구실) ;
  • 한충진 (울산대학교 전기공학부 조선해양IT융합연구실) ;
  • 김제욱 (울산대학교 전기공학부 조선해양IT융합연구실) ;
  • 오훈 (울산대학교 전기공학부 조선해양IT융합연구실)
  • Received : 2012.08.23
  • Accepted : 2012.10.12
  • Published : 2012.10.30

Abstract

Since the existing protocols separated mobility management part and routing protocol part in their design and used a flooding, they suffer from the high control overhead, thereby limiting performance. In this paper, we use a tree-based mobility management method and present a simple and efficient routing protocol that exploits the topology information which is built additionally through mobility management. Thus, the mobility management and the routing protocol closely cooperate to optimize control overhead. Furthermore, we use a progressive path discovery method to alleviate traffic congestion around IG and a unicast-based broadcast method to increase the reliability of message delivery and to judge link validity promptly. The proposed protocol reduces control overhead greatly and works in a stable manner even with the large number of nodes and high mobility. This was proven by comparing with the AODV protocol that employs the hybrid mobility management protocol.

인프라구조 기반의 이동 애드혹 네트워크를 위한 기존의 프로토콜들은 이동성 관리와 라우팅 프로토콜을 분리하여 설계되었을 뿐만 아니라 플러딩을 사용하기 때문에 높은 제어 오버헤드를 발생시킨다. 본 논문에서는 트리기반의 이동성관리 방식을 사용하며 이 과정에서 부수적으로 구축되는 토폴로지 정보를 활용하는 단순하고 효율적인 라우팅 프로토콜을 제시한다. 제안하는 라우팅 프로토콜은 패킷 전송 과정에서 트리를 구성하는 중요 링크에 대한 파손을 발견하는 경우에 토폴로지 정보를 신속히 갱신한다. 이러한 방식으로 이동성 관리와 라우팅 프로토콜은 서로 협력한다. 또한 IG 주위에 트래픽 혼잡을 줄이기 위하여 점진적 경로탐색 방식을 사용하였으며, 제어메시지 전송 신뢰성을 높이고 링크 유효성을 신속히 판단할 수 있도록 유니케스트 기반의 브로드케스트 방식을 사용하였다. 그리고 플러딩을 배제하고 제어메시지 전송의 최적화를 통하여 오버헤드를 크게 줄임으로써 노드의 수가 증가하고 이동성이 높은 경우에도 안정적으로 작동할 수 있도록 하였다. 시뮬레이션을 통해서 제안하는 프로토콜이 Hybrid 이동성 관리 방식을 사용하는 AODV에 비하여 우수한 성능과 확장성을 갖는다는 것을 입증하였다.

Keywords

References

  1. A. Iwata, C.-C. Chiang, G. Pei, M. Gerla, and T.-W. Chen, "Scalable routing strategies for ad hoc wireless networks," IEEE Journal on Selected Areas in Communications, Special Issue on Wireless Ad Hoc Networks, vol. 17, no.8, pp. 1369-1379, Aug. 1999.
  2. C. Perkins, "IP Mobility Support," Request For Comments (Standard) 2002, Internet Engineering Task Force, Oct. 1996.
  3. C. E. Perkins and E. M. Royer, "Ad-hoc on-demand distance vector routing," Second IEEE Workshop on Mobile Computing Systems and Applications, pp. 90-100, Feb. 1999.
  4. C. E. Perkins and P. Bhagwat, "Highly dynamic destination-sequenced distance-vector routing (DSDV) for mobile computers," ACM SIGCOMM: Computer Communications Review, vol. 24, no. 4, pp. 234-244, Oct. 1994. https://doi.org/10.1145/190809.190336
  5. D. B. John and D. A. Malz, "Dynamic source routing in ad hoc wireless networks," Mobile Computing, edited by T. Imielinski and H. Korth, Kluwer Academic Publishers, ch.5, pp. 153-181, 1996
  6. D. Jonsson, F. Alriksson, T. Larsson, P. Johansson and J. G. Maguire, "MIPMANET - mobile IP for mobile ad hoc networks," in Proceedings of IEEE/ACM Workshop on Mobile and Ad Hoc Networking and Computing (MobiHoc'00), pp. 75-85, Aug. 2000.
  7. H. Ammari and H. El-Rewini, "Integration of mobile ad hoc networks and the Internet using mobile gateways," in Proceedings of 18th International Symposium of Parallel and Distributed Processing, vol. 13, pp. 218b, Apr. 2004.
  8. H. El-Moshrify, M.A. Mangoud, and M. Rizk, "Gateway discovery in ad hoc on demand distance vector (AODV) routing for Internet connectivity," in Radio Science Conference, NRSC 2007, pp. 1-8, Mar. 2007.
  9. H. Oh and S.Y. Yun, "Proactive cluster-based distance vector (PCDV) routing protocol for mobile ad hoc networks," IEICE Transactions on Communications, vol. E90-B, no.6 , pp.1390-1399, Jun. 1, 2007. https://doi.org/10.1093/ietcom/e90-b.6.1390
  10. H. Oh, "A tree-based approach for the Internet connectivity of mobile ad hoc networks," Journal of Communications and Networks, vol. 11, no. 3, pp. 261-270, Jun. 2009. https://doi.org/10.1109/JCN.2009.6391330
  11. J. Broch, D. A. Maltz and D. B. Johnson, "Supporting Hierarchy and Heterogeneous Interfaces in Multi-Hop Wireless Ad Hoc Networks," in Proc. Int'l. Symp. Parallel Architecture, Algorithms, and Networks, Perth, Australia, pp. 370-375, Jun. 1999.
  12. J. Jubin and J. D. Tornow, "The DARPA packet radio network protocols," Proceedings of the IEEE, vol. 75, no. 1, pp. 21-32, Jan. 1987. https://doi.org/10.1109/PROC.1987.13702
  13. J. McQuillan, I. Richer, and E. Rosen, "The new routing algorithm for the ARPANET," IEEE Transaction on Communications, vol. 28, no. 5, pp. 711,719, May. 1980.
  14. M. Caleffi, G. Ferraiuolo, L. Paura, "Augmented tree-based routing protocol for scalable ad hoc networks," in the Proceedings of the IEEE Internatonal Conference Mobile Adhoc and Sensor Systems, 2007. MASS 2007. pp. 1-6, Oct. 2007.
  15. P. Jacquet, P. Muhlethaler, and A. Qayyum, "Optimized link state routing protocol," IETF MANET, Internet Draft, Nov. 1998.
  16. P. Ruiz, A. Gomez-Skarmeta, "Enhanced internet connectivity for hybrid ad hoc networks through adaptive gateway discovery," in Proceedings of the 29th Annual IEEE International Conference on Local Computer Networks (LCN'04), pp. 370-377, Nov. 2004.
  17. P. Ratanchandani, and R. Kravets, "A hybrid approach to Internet connectivity for mobile ad hoc networks," in Proceeding of IEEE WCNC 2003, pp. 1522-1527, Mar. 2003.
  18. Y.-C. Tseng, C.-C. Shen, and W.-T. Chen "Integrating mobile IP with ad hoc networks," IEEE Computer, vol. 36, no. 5, May 2003.
  19. Y. Sun, E. M. Belding-Royer, and C. E. Perkins, "Internet connectivity for ad hoc mobile networks," International Journal of Wireless Information Networks special issue on Mobile Ad Hoc Networks (MANETs): Standards, Research, and Applications, vol. 9, no. 2, pp. 75-88, Apr. 2002.
  20. T-D Han, H. Oh, "Detecting and resolving a loop in the tree-based mobility management protocol," LNCS 6104, pp. 583-592, May 2010.
  21. W. Peng, Z. Li, F. Haddix, "A practical spanning tree based MANET routing algorithm," in: the Proceedings of the 14th International Conference Computer Communications and Networks, 2005. ICCCN 2005, pp. 19-24, Oct. 2005.
  22. S.W. Lee, C.T. Ngo, T.D. Han, J.W. Kim, H. Oh, "Resolving the funneling effect in the node mobility management of infrastructure-based mobile ad hoc networks)," The Journal of Korea Information and Communications Society, vol. 36, no. 12 pp. 984-993, Dec. 2011 https://doi.org/10.7840/KICS.2011.36A.12.984